The importance of summer internships in architecture

Architecture is a field where practical experience holds immense value. While academic knowledge is important, it is through internships that aspiring architects can apply their skills in real-world settings. Summer internships in architecture provide the perfect platform for students and recent graduates to gain hands-on experience and understand the intricacies of the profession.

Internships allow you to work alongside experienced architects who can mentor you and provide guidance throughout the process. Being exposed to real projects, you’ll learn how to work within constraints, meet client expectations, and collaborate with other professionals in the industry. These experiences are invaluable in shaping your understanding of NYC architecture internships and preparing you for a successful career.

Moreover, summer internships provide an opportunity to build a strong professional network. By working in established architectural firms or design studios, you’ll have the chance to connect with industry professionals who can become valuable contacts for future job opportunities. The relationships you build during your internship can open doors to mentorship, references, and even potential job offers.

Benefits of participating in architecture internships

Participating in architecture internships during the summer comes with numerous benefits that can greatly enhance your career prospects. Here are some of the key advantages of pursuing these opportunities:

1. Hands-on Experience: Summer internships allow you to gain practical experience by working on real projects. This hands-on experience is essential for developing your technical skills and understanding how architectural concepts are applied in practice. It also gives you the chance to work with industry-standard tools and technologies, enabling you to become proficient in their usage.

2. Portfolio Development: Internships provide the opportunity to work on diverse projects, helping you build a strong portfolio. A well-rounded portfolio showcasing your skills and design abilities is crucial in the competitive field of architecture. Employers often look for candidates with a solid portfolio that demonstrates their creativity, problem-solving skills, and ability to translate ideas into practical designs. Internships allow you to add real-world projects to your portfolio, making it more impressive and increasing your chances of securing future job opportunities.

3. Networking Opportunities: Building a strong professional network is vital in any industry, and architecture is no exception. Internships give you the chance to connect with professionals, establish relationships, and expand your network. Networking can lead to mentorship, career advice, and potential job offers in the future. By making a positive impression during your internship, you increase the likelihood of being remembered by industry professionals who may recommend you for future opportunities.

4. Industry Insight: Working in a professional architectural setting exposes you to the inner workings of the industry. You’ll gain valuable insights into the architectural process, project management, client interactions, and collaboration with other disciplines. This firsthand experience allows you to understand the challenges and realities of the profession and helps you develop a more holistic approach to architecture.

5. Professional Development: Internships provide a platform for personal and professional growth. Through mentorship and guidance from experienced architects, you’ll develop important skills such as problem-solving, communication, time management, and teamwork. These skills are not only essential for success in architecture but are transferable to any professional setting. Internships also offer opportunities for self-reflection and improvement, allowing you to identify your strengths and areas for growth.

Top architecture firms offering summer internships

When it comes to summer architecture internships, several top firms offer exceptional opportunities for aspiring architects. These firms are known for their innovative designs, prestigious projects, and commitment to nurturing young talent. Here are some of the top architecture firms that provide summer internships:

1. Foster + Partners: Foster + Partners is a globally renowned architectural firm known for its iconic designs and sustainable approach. They offer summer internships where interns work alongside experienced architects on various projects. From high-rise buildings to cultural landmarks, Foster + Partners provides a diverse range of opportunities for interns to gain invaluable experience.

2. Gensler: Gensler is one of the largest architecture and design firms worldwide, with a reputation for creating innovative and sustainable spaces. Their summer internship program allows interns to work on real projects and collaborate with multidisciplinary teams. Gensler’s commitment to mentorship and professional growth makes it an ideal choice for aspiring architects.

3. Zaha Hadid Architects: Zaha Hadid Architects is known for its futuristic and groundbreaking designs. Their summer internship program offers interns the chance to work on international projects and gain exposure to cutting-edge architectural practices. With a focus on innovation and creativity, Zaha Hadid Architects provides a unique learning experience for interns.

4. Snøhetta: Snøhetta is an internationally acclaimed architecture and design firm known for its focus on sustainability and integration with nature. Their summer internship program offers interns the opportunity to work on projects that emphasize the relationship between architecture and the environment. Snøhetta’s commitment to sustainable design and social responsibility makes it an attractive choice for environmentally conscious architects.

5. BIG (Bjarke Ingels Group): BIG is a renowned architectural firm known for its bold and innovative designs. Their summer internship program offers interns the chance to work on high-profile projects and gain exposure to BIG’s design philosophy. With a focus on pushing boundaries and challenging traditional architecture, BIG provides a unique learning environment for interns.

How to find and apply for architecture internships

Finding and applying for architecture internships requires proactive effort and strategic planning. Here are some steps to help you navigate the process effectively:

1. Research: Start by researching architectural firms, design studios, and organizations that offer summer internships. Look for firms that align with your interests and career goals. Explore their websites, social media platforms, and online job boards to gather information about their internship programs. Pay attention to application deadlines, eligibility criteria, and required application materials.

2. Networking: Networking plays a crucial role in finding internship opportunities. Reach out to professionals in the industry, attend architecture events and workshops, and join online communities to expand your network. Engage with architects, professors, and alumni who can provide guidance and recommendations for internships. Networking can often lead to insider information about upcoming internship opportunities that may not be widely advertised.

3. Prepare your application materials: Once you’ve identified the internships you’re interested in, prepare your application materials. This typically includes a resume, portfolio, and cover letter. Tailor your resume to highlight relevant skills, coursework, and any previous architectural experience. Ensure that your portfolio showcases your best work and reflects your design abilities. Craft a compelling cover letter that expresses your passion for architecture and explains why you’re interested in the specific internship.

4. Apply strategically: When applying for internships, it’s important to be strategic and prioritize the opportunities that best align with your goals. Customize your application for each internship, emphasizing how your skills and experiences make you a strong candidate. Pay attention to application instructions and deadlines, and submit your application well in advance to avoid any last-minute complications.

5. Follow up: After submitting your application, follow up with a thank-you email or message to express your gratitude for the opportunity to apply. This demonstrates your professionalism and genuine interest in the internship. If you don’t hear back within a reasonable time frame, it’s acceptable to send a polite follow-up email to inquire about the status of your application.

Tips for creating an impressive architecture internship application

Creating an impressive architecture internship application can significantly increase your chances of securing your dream opportunity. Here are some tips to make your application stand out:

1. Showcase your creativity: Architecture is a creative field, and employers look for candidates who can think outside the box. Use your portfolio and cover letter to showcase your unique design perspective and creative problem-solving skills. Include a variety of projects that demonstrate your ability to conceptualize and execute innovative designs.

2. Highlight relevant coursework and skills: In your resume and cover letter, highlight any coursework, projects, or skills that are relevant to the internship you’re applying for. This could include courses in architectural design, building construction, sustainable design, or digital modeling. Emphasize how these experiences have prepared you for the internship and make you a valuable asset to the firm.

3. Demonstrate your passion: Architecture is a field that requires passion and dedication. Use your application materials to convey your enthusiasm for the profession. Explain why you’re drawn to architecture, what inspires you, and how you envision making a positive impact in the field. Employers value candidates who are genuinely passionate about their work and who demonstrate a commitment to lifelong learning and growth.

4. Pay attention to detail: Architecture is a detail-oriented profession, and attention to detail is crucial in the application process as well. Ensure that your application materials are well-organized, free of errors, and visually appealing. Proofread your resume, portfolio, and cover letter multiple times to eliminate any typos or grammatical errors. A polished and professional application demonstrates your commitment to excellence.

5. Be genuine and authentic: Finally, be yourself throughout the application process. Employers value authenticity and want to get a sense of who you are as a person and as an aspiring architect. Let your personality shine through your application materials and show why you’re a unique and valuable addition to their team.
